John E. Bates, 86, of Port Charlotte, Florida passed away Tuesday, April 5, 2016 at Tidewell Hospice Inc. in Port Charlotte.
John was born to James and Jessie Bates on April 18, 1929 in Seattle, WA and moved to Port Charlotte in 1982 from Michigan. John was a Korean War veteran in the U.S. Army and he was a member of Loyal Order of Moose Lodge, B.P.O. Elks Lodge and American Legion Post 110 all of Port Charlotte. He was a wonderful man who enjoyed life to the fullest and will be remembered by all who loved and knew him.
Survivors include his loving wife of 17 years, Doris; his step-daughter, Patricia Coe of Woodbridge, VA; 2 step-sons, Robert Carroll of Long Valley, NJ and Richard Carroll of Flanders, NJ and his brother, James Ott of Idaho.
